How to Read a Mage Build

A mage build usually starts with a first item that defines your identity — burst, poke or damage-over-time — followed by ability power, penetration and often some mana or cooldown reduction. Understanding what each item gives you matters more than memorising a fixed order.

Core Stats Mages Want

Ability power increases your damage; magic penetration helps that damage land against opponents who build magic resist; and cooldown or ability haste lets you cast more often. Many mages also want mana or mana-sustain early so they can keep using spells. Balancing these is the heart of itemising a mage.

Defensive and Utility Items

Against heavy burst or dive, a defensive item — such as one with a protective active — can keep you alive long enough to deal your damage. It is often correct to buy survivability over a third damage item when you are being focused. Read situational options on the items page and adapt each game.
